need to find an alignment shop
just finished rebuilding the front end of my camaro and need to get it aligned. I am going to need 2 things:
1) Decent alignment setting to make the car handle awesome ( i was thinking -0.5 camber, -4.5 caster, and 0.0 toe)
2) decent alignment shop in central NJ that will do the alignment to my specs and will do a good job. (most jersey shops I have seen look like they just hired people who should have kept their jobs as grocery baggers)
